In respect to this,How big is a one ounce gold coin?
A one ounce gold coin is about the size of a half dollar… (bear in mind that a Silver dollar is about 3/4 ounce of 90% silver)… The one ounce Gold Eagle Coin is not 24k gold…but it does contain one Troy ounce of gold…The diameter is 32.7mm and the thickness is 2.87mm…this converts to 0.1130 inches thick and 1.287402 inches in diameter…
Similarly,When did the size of one dollar bill change?
Since that time there have been many redesigns of the one dollar bill. In 1928 the size of the one dollar bill was changed to the size that we consider normal today. Before 1928, all dollar bills were about 35% bigger. It wasn’t until 1963 that the dollar bill took on the design and color scheme we see on modern money.

What kind of currency does the United States use?
The United States issues paper currency and coins to pay for purchases, taxes, and debts. American paper currency is issued in seven denominations: $1, $2, $5, $10, $20, $50, and $100.
